The Moment of Finality.

A beauty of the finest splendor…captivating Seizing the rooms attention on the inhale Now a shrinking shell of her former self Caught in a chemical coma to ease her pain Murmuring fate in silences void…foreboding Her eyes not seeing the milieu’s approach Those illusory walls protection now ravaged She stands naked before bereavements eyes As the nights pass I sit at her bedside…steady No corollary thought as the clock keeps pace I allay the fear by a whisper looking for lucidity While her random gasps for life squeeze within me Soft regrets for the misery I’ve caused…repentant Adrift in the words I bellowed in toxic anger Yearning to drink of the venom washed over you To share one moment in the clarity of forgiveness The scent of a spring dawn’s beauty fills the air…mocking Stroking your hair I stutter out my final goodbye Ready to be chained to the morose you absolve me Taking with you my weighted anguish with simple words Mom opened her eyes one last time and said…I love you too…
